What should I do in order to make my fans, connected on the gpo, starting on computer boot ?
I have the lk202-24-usb rev 1.4

Thank's :P

Posted: Wed Nov 26, 2003 11:57 am
by FrankFuss
You must solder a jumper so the display is powered by the 3.5" floppy cable and enter default PWM settings for each advanced GPO. See the following thread:

Jester wrote:I don't have this jumper on my lcd, I have a "resistance"(scuse me I'm french and I don't know the word for this :D ) instead :cry:
If there is a resistor on the jumper, the resistor is 0 ohm... it's jumped, the resistor is there as a "fuse"... just issue the commands to the LCD for the default state you want the fans and plug in the 3.5" power cable and you'r good to go.
